Description

The object of Leinen los! is to push a little wooden ship, following the race track while doing so and avoiding the buoys. This might be easy to do, except that the ships are composed of two separate parts: the motor and the rest of the ship, with the latter part tending to turn in every direction except the way you want to go, but since you must move the ship by pushing on the motor with only one finger, sometimes you can't help traveling in directions unintended. Players take turns via a chronometer/egg timer, and the first player to reach the end of the track wins!
